/// <summary> /// Add a MOD(3rd party) application to the Application Launcher. Use ApplicationLauncherButton.VisibleInScenes to set where the button should be displayed. /// </summary> /// <remarks> /// Note that the application launcher is destroyed when the player exits to the main menu. If the player then /// loads up a new save the application launcher will be recreated and you will have to re-add your button. /// Register for GameEvents.onGUIApplicationLauncherDestroyed and GameEvents.onGUIApplicationLauncherReady /// to detect when the application launcher has been destroyed and when it has been re-created. /// </remarks> /// <param name="onTrue">Callback for when the button is toggeled on</param> /// <param name="onFalse">Callback for when the button is toggeled off</param> /// <param name="onHover">Callback for when the mouse is hovering over the button</param> /// <param name="onHoverOut">Callback for when the mouse hoveris off the button</param> /// <param name="onEnable">Callback for when the button is shown or enabled by the application launcher</param> /// <param name="onDisable">Callback for when the button is hidden or disabled by the application launcher</param> /// <param name="visibleInScenes">The "scenes" this button will be visible in. For example VisibleInScenes = ApplicationLauncher.AppScenes.FLIGHT | ApplicationLauncher.AppScenes.MAPVIEW;</param> /// <param name="texture">The 38x38 Texture to use for the button icon.</param> /// <returns></returns> public extern ApplicationLauncherButton AddModApplication(RUIToggleButton.OnTrue onTrue, RUIToggleButton.OnFalse onFalse, RUIToggleButton.OnHover onHover, RUIToggleButton.OnHoverOut onHoverOut, RUIToggleButton.OnEnable onEnable, RUIToggleButton.OnDisable onDisable, ApplicationLauncher.AppScenes visibleInScenes, Texture texture);
